Rules

What is that?
You make a model for someone else's army. A unique model to be fielded amongst your customers general list. It would be a best of your ability model. It should be converted, based, and painted to the best of your ability! 

How would you do it?
Get a list of everyone who wants to participate, assign them a number, and randomly draw a number from a hat (also check the VOLUNTEER! section below). That person makes a model for the next person drawn, etc. Your customer will tell you his army, and what type of guy he wants. Say a tactical marine, a guardian, whatever. The model has to fit the wargear for that unit type, but it may be converted however the maker wants!

When?
Last day for registering is Monday the 31 of March, 2008.
All models should be completed and shipped by the end of May! 2 months is plenty of time for 1 model

Restrictions!
-You shouldn't ask for something really expensive. For example, you can't say "I want a venerable dreadnought!" We can put a maximum price (unless the maker wants to spend more), whatever everyone agrees on.
-You should be moderately skilled with converting and painting. To keep everyone happy and no one bitter, everyone will want something of decent quality. So if you are a really bad painter, I'd ask you sit this one out 

*people will also be matched up with location restrictions. I.E. Canada and us people won't get people from Europe or Aussie. this prevents uber expensive / annoying shipping, etc..*

VOLUNTEER!
Spot a member who you would really like to make a model for? Have the bits to do a really cool conversion for X? Volunteer to make an item for a person! Just put under your ap, I volunteer to make X's model! NOTE: You cannot volunteer for someone who already has a person making their model! So please check that first. Anyone who doesn't have a volunteer to do their model will be randomly drawn from a hate and assigned someone!

How to register?
Send me a PM or reply to this thread with the following info:

1) Europe, Aussie, or USA/Canada?
2) Army theme and colour scheme (if you have a SINGLE picture showing your scheme pm it to me)
3) What unit do you want made for you for under $15 or under retail? (a marine, a biker, a terminator, etc)
